Israel Kills Gaza’s New Prime Minister

Hamas senior official and newly appointed Prime Minister of Gaza, Ismail Barhoum, has been killed in an Israeli attack.

Barhoum had taken office less than a week ago after the killing of former Prime Minister Issam Da’alis on March 18. Israeli Defense Minister Yoav Gallant confirmed Barhoum’s death.

On Sunday night (March 23), Israeli forces targeted Nasser Hospital in Khan Younis, Gaza. The attack resulted in the deaths of Barhoum and another individual while injuring eight others. Hamas confirmed his death, stating that he was receiving medical treatment at the hospital at the time of the attack.

Israeli Defense Minister said, “On Sunday evening, the Israel Defense Forces successfully eliminated senior Hamas official Ismail Barhoum at Nasser Hospital in Khan Younis.” He added that Barhoum had succeeded Issam Da’alis, who was killed a few days earlier.

Footage of the attack was captured by Al Jazeera and BBC Arabic. A video circulating on social media shows an Al Jazeera journalist preparing for a live report outside the hospital when a missile-like object strikes the facility, causing a fire. The fire has since been brought under control, but the hospital suffered further damage.
